It has been the first device launched in india .
so if you buy pi for (rs9999) you will get 1 year warranty in india .
That is a big thing before buying any item.
on the other hand you buy a kindle or sony prs you will have to pay the shipping 40$ and custom duties around 100$ raising its cost to 350$ without any warranty.
It in fact is a rebranded white-label (OEM) product from chinese OEM manufacturer C-Double Tek from Guangdong.
